The paper presents a novel multi-agent framework designed for automated enterprise analytics and insight generation, leveraging the CrewAI platform. This system employs five specialized AI agents arranged in a sequential pipeline, each responsible for a distinct part of the business intelligence process. These agents collaboratively handle natural language queries, retrieve and analyze relevant data, create visualizations using the Model Context Protocol (MCP), and ultimately deliver actionable insights to users. Key features of the platform include a robust defense-in-depth security architecture, ensuring multi-tenant data isolation, and a query parameterization mechanism. This mechanism allows conversational insights to be transformed into reusable dashboard components, enhancing the utility and longevity of the generated analyses. Extensive evaluation across 300 end-to-end test cases, using both synthetic and production enterprise datasets, demonstrated impressive results. The platform achieved 95.3% functional accuracy, a mean response latency of 24 seconds, and a high response quality score of 4.52/5.0 as assessed by an LLM-as-a-Judge framework, with a 93.0% hallucination-free rate. This represents a significant improvement over single-agent baselines, confirming the architectural generalizability and evaluator reliability across different LLM backends and human expert validation.
